Tom Ford Shoes for Men
After serving as creative director for two well-known fashion houses, Tom Ford created his own company in 2006 and named it for himself. The company offers a variety of apparel for men and women.
What are some parts of a shoe?There are many parts to a shoe including:
- Breast: The forward-facing part of the heel under the sole.
- Counter: A stiff piece of fabric placed between the lining and the upper to help the shoe keep its shape.
- Feather: The part of the shoe where the sole meets the upper.
- Puff: A reinforcement added to the toe of the shoe to help it keep its shape.
- Welt:A small strip of metal joining the sole and the upper.
The company offers a variety of choices, which include the following:
- Boots: Many styles feature Italian leather or suede with elastic side panels and rubber lug soles.
- Brogue: These leather options have decorative vamps and toe caps.
- Espadrilles: This suede footwear usually has a rubber sole.
- Chain loafers: This velvet footwear has a chain across the top.
- Derby: These leather options have open lacing.
- Hi-top sneakers: These choices often feature a combination of natural leather and suede.
- Lace-ups: These suede shoes have short heels with eyelets sewn under the vamps.
- Monk strap: This semiformal shoe features elastic and buckles.
- Sandals: These slide-on leather shoes usually have chains across the uppers.
- Sneakers: These styles are made of leather, calf hide, or suede.

This company offers men's footwear in a variety of materials including:
- Alligator: Boots are made with alligator skin.
- Velvet: Slippers and other shoes are made with velvet and often have silk linings.
- Leather: Tom Ford makes a variety of styles from calf leather.
- Nylon: Sneakers often combine nylon with leather.
The company makes shoes ranging from United States size 6 to size 16. All standard-production choices have a medium D width.
